Interesting Stats about Atherton

  • Atherton has a population of 7,724 with a median age of 46, suggesting a mature community.
  • Average household size stands at 2.2, indicating a preference for smaller family units.
  • Couples without children make up 28.7% of households, while single-parent families account for 34.5%.
  • The majority of dwellings are separate houses (74.1%), appealing to families and those seeking more space.
  • Nearly 59.0% of properties are owner-occupied, reflecting a stable housing market in the suburb.

One of the defining characteristics of Atherton is its stunning natural environment. Surrounded by rolling hills, fertile farmlands, and lush rainforests, the suburb is a haven for nature enthusiasts. The area is renowned for its temperate climate and bountiful natural produce, including fresh fruits like bananas, avocados, and coffee. Furthermore, the proximity to national parks, such as the stunning Danbulla National Park and the craggy peaks of the Great Dividing Range, provides residents with ample opportunities for hiking, mountain biking, and enjoying the spectacular landscapes unique to this part of Queensland.

Education is well catered for in Atherton, with several reputable schools offering quality education for families. Atherton State School and St Joseph’s Catholic School are two established institutions known for their strong community involvement and high academic standards. Additionally, the suburb's proximity to the local campus of TAFE Queensland opens up further educational opportunities, not just for school leavers but also for those looking to upskill or adapt to the evolving job market.

Public transport options in Atherton enable residents to commute effortlessly to nearby towns such as Malanda and Mareeba, and the direct access to the Kennedy Highway facilitates ease of travel to Cairns and beyond.
